WebMar 15, 2024 · A downtrend describes the movement of a stock towards a lower price from its previous state. It will exist as long as there is a continuation of lower highs and lower lows in the stock chart. The downtrend is reversed once the conditions are no longer met. WebA downtrend describes the price movement of a financial asset when the overall direction is downward. In a downtrend, each successive peak and trough is lower than the ones found earlier in the trend. Price action forms the basis for all technical analyses of a stock, commodity or other asset charts. Many short-term traders rely exclusively on price action and the formations and trends extrapolated from it to make trading decisions.
